"The Digital Made Analog"
an Installation Art Showcase
Thursday 21 October, 7-10pm
at the US Art Authority, 2906 Fruth Street, Austin, TX 78705 (map)
$7 online, $10 at the door
A selection of analog representations of digital theory by Austin-local artists including: "The Quest for the Dark Planet" miniatures by John P Funk, "Su-Tam Y K Siu" a fluxus card game by Ralph Barton, analog Facebook by Jeanne Stern, psychic collage fortune card readings by Clothi, and a projected life-painting series curated by Ryan Hovenweep. Music by Artificial Life Preserve and more.
